For example, some institutions may place a student on probation, suspension, or dismissal if their GPA is below 2.0 or even 2.5. This can include an official police report if you have been a victim of a crime, a death certificate if you have suffered a bereavement, or a dated letter from a doctor or hospital. If youre on academic suspension because of your low GPA, you might be able to take courses at another college during the period of your suspension, and then possibly transfer those credits to your original school if and when your suspension is lifted. (That amounts to a C.) However, be aware that certain rules and stipulations apply for transfer credits. You will be entitled to keep an amount of the funds calculated from how many days of the course you have completed and you will be obliged to repay any surplus payments you have already received for the remainder of the year.
